5 Reasons why businesses fail in Nigeria
- Poor Location; its been said over and over again; location is everything! Because of the way humans are wired, it’s not always easy for the customers to switch to a new brand, or product. Its always good to go to a location where you can have the first mover advantage, so you won't be in competition with businesses that had grown there over time and which people are now used to. I highly recommend the blue ocean strategy for small businesses about to start up. This book talks about the simultaneous pursuit of differentiation and low cost to open up a new market space and create new demand for businesses.
- Misalignment with your customers; its imperative to define your customers and to align with them. This means seeing what they see, feeling what they feel, hearing what they hear, smelling what they smell; you need to do unto them as they would want to be done to. But we did the opposite; we did unto them as we would want to be done to. Businesses that fail to align with their customer’s needs will eventually produce products and services that no one wants.
- No staying power; its common knowledge that you may not make much money in the first few years in business; but you need to break even nonetheless. That means making enough money to cover your running costs for the period of time. Some businesses fold when they don’t make profit in the first few years.
- Inappropriate business planning and execution. Some people get a fantastic idea and they rush off into production without any planning whatsoever. Without understanding their landscape. Without knowing if someone in their chosen market already is into similar business. There just seems to be lots of gap. Small businesses need to have a solid business plan. A good business plan not only helps when trying to secure finances for the business but it also aids in understanding different areas of the business and answering lots of question that that the business would need answers to later on. However execution is everything, you may have the best ideas, but when if you fail at execution, the idea amounts to nothing
- Managerial inefficiencies; to run businesses successfully, the owners need to be actively involved. What you don’t monitor efficiently you lose track of.
